1. Wacaco Nanopresso

The handheld espresso maker made by Wacaco uses up to 18 bars of pressure to hand-pump out coffee that's similar to the taste of a cafe as you can get without the hefty price tag. The outer casing is made of TPV (a durable rubber that has been vulcanized) and the piston shaft and shower screen are stainless steel. There's also a portafilter as well as a filter basket, as well as a spring device inside the top cap that helps add extra pressure for coarser coffee.

Nanopresso is simple to use. Simply fill the water tank with water, then place the filter in and then place the coffee you grind in the portafilter, and pump. You can remove the handle and pump assembly to make hot water. The whole unit is small, light and easy to carry and store.

In the water tank you'll find a manual and a small scoop that can be used as an espresso tamper. Cleaning is easy: empty the tank, loosen the portafilter, and dispose of the coffee grounds that are ruined. And since the plastic body holds some of the oils used for the brewing process, it's recommended to clean it thoroughly on a regular basis.

4. Aeropress Go

Aeropress Go Aeropress Go is the smaller version of original aeropress. This model is lighter and easier to clean than an aeropress that is french-style. This is ideal for van life or car camping. It takes less than a minute to make an espresso, and it tastes great! It's simple to clean up - just toss the grounds into the garbage. This is especially helpful for those who live off the grid and are trying to Leave No Trace.

It comes with a mug which can also double as a travel case. It also has filter holder and scoop for ground coffee, so you don't have to pack those separately.

Another interesting feature is that the AeroPress Go can be used to make brewing inverted. You can try cold brew if you like. It also comes with a lid that keeps the coffee from spilling. 8. Hario Mini Mill

Hario is well-known for its variety of coffee equipment around the globe. Hario's V60 pour-over kit is a popular choice, and for good reason. However, they also manufacture several other items that make the process of the process of brewing coffee simple.

The Mini Mill is a compact, manual grinder that uses ceramic burrs. They are regarded as superior to stainless steel as they lessen friction that occurs during grinding. This reduces heat, which in turn preserves more delicious oils contained within the whole beans.

This is a small, lightweight grinder that fits easily in your bag for travel. It can easily grind enough coffee to make one or two cups, and is easy to pour into your favorite mug.
